The Carnegie Endowment for International Peace is a foreign policy think-tank dedicated to advancing cooperation between nations and promoting active international engagement by the United States. Each year the Carnegie Endowment Junior Fellowship offers approximately 12 one-year fellowships to uniquely qualified graduating seniors and individuals who have graduated during the past academic year.

Junior Fellows provide research assistance to scholars working on the Carnegie Endowment programs.  Junior Fellows have the opportunity to conduct research for books, co-author journal articles and policy papers, participate in meetings with high-level officials, contribute to congressional testimony and organize briefings attended by scholars, journalists and government officials.

This particular award cycle is for students who are graduating seniors or students who have graduated during the last academic year. Anyone who has started graduate studies is ineligible for consideration (except in cases where the student has completed a joint bachelor’s/master’s degree program).
